Senior Development Operations Engineer (DevOps)

Full-Time Position | Remote (US)

About Us

Rapta is revolutionizing American manufacturing with our AI-powered vision systems. Our cutting-edge software platform expands manufacturing capacity 30% by reducing errors 90%+ and automating quality control and inspection processes. We're looking for a talented senior development operations engineer to join our mission and make a real impact.

Position Overview

We're seeking an experienced senior development operations (DevOps) engineer to own the build, test, and deployment pipeline for our distributed computer vision platform running at edge sites across customer manufacturing floors. This is a full-time remote position working directly with our engineering team to harden our release process, drive deployment automation, and pioneer LLM-driven test generation and validation at Rapta.

What You'll Do

  • Own and evolve the end-to-end release pipeline — branching strategy, build orchestration, artifact promotion, and rollback — across our Bazel monorepo and Python deployable units
  • Design and maintain Ansible-driven fleet automation for heterogeneous Linux edge nodes (Ubuntu LTS, NVIDIA driver stacks, Docker with NVIDIA runtime)
  • Manage all update tooling, currently written in Golang
  • Build LLM-powered automated testing systems: test generation from specs, flake triage, log/failure analysis, regression diffing, and release-note synthesis from commit and ticket history
  • Harden CI/CD for offline and bandwidth-constrained deployment targets (airgap wheel distribution, signed artifacts, deterministic builds)
  • Drive observability for releases — deployment telemetry, version drift detection, and post-deploy health validation across the fleet
  • Mentor engineers on release hygiene, reproducible builds, and infrastructure-as-code practices

What We're Looking For

  • 10+ years of professional experience in release engineering, DevOps, or SRE roles shipping production Linux systems
  • Deep curiosity for software, infrastructure, and applied AI — particularly using LLMs as production engineering tools, not just chat assistants
  • Expert-level Python (3.8+) with a strong grasp of packaging, dependency resolution, and PEP 440 versioning discipline
  • Demonstrated ownership of Linux fleets at scale — kernel, systemd, networking, package management
  • Excellence in technical communication, runbook authorship, and post-incident documentation
  • Strong systems thinking — comfortable reasoning about failure modes across hardware, OS, container, and application layers

Required Technical Skills

  • Expert proficiency with Ansible (roles, dynamic inventory, idempotent design); working knowledge of Terraform
  • Expert proficiency with Docker, including creation and lifecycle management of containers, image hardening, registry management and installing & configuring the NVIDIA container runtime
  • Production experience with Linux administration: systemd, networking (VLANs, DHCP, DNS), kernel/driver management (especially NVIDIA/DKMS), package and APT internals
  • Strong Python skills focused on tooling, automation, packaging (wheels, pip, private indexes), and subprocess/CI integration
  • Proficiency with Git workflows, branching strategies, and modern CI/CD systems (GitHub Actions, GitLab CI, or equivalent)
  • Experience designing and operating automated test infrastructure — unit, integration, hardware-in-the-loop, and end-to-end
  • Practical experience using LLMs (Anthropic, OpenAI, or local) as part of engineering workflows — test generation, code review augmentation, log analysis, or agentic tooling

Nice to Have

  • Bazel or similar monorepo build systems
  • Edge or embedded deployment experience
  • Tailscale, WireGuard, or zero-trust networking in production
  • gRPC/protobuf service ecosystems
  • Vault, PKI, or secrets management at fleet scale
  • Background in regulated or compliance-driven environments (CMMC, ISO 27001, SOC 2)
